Ban on NASA anti-IEBC demos on CBD lifted by the High Court

The High Court on Tuesday temporarily lifted a ban on the National Super Alliance anti-IEBC demonstrations in the city centre.

The lifting of the ban was issued by High Court Judge Chacha Mwita

Acting Interior Cabinet Secretary Dr Fred Matiang’i issued the ban last week.

Matinag’i while citing the Public Order Act said NASA protestors were restricted from picketing with the central business district of Nairobi, Mombasa and Kisumu.

He said the protests have posed a danger to businesses and property.

However, NASA through its CEO Norman Magaya moved to court to challenge Matiang’i’s directive which the coalition had earlier termed as unconstitutional and illegal.

According to Justice Mwita, the suspension binds until the case lodged by Magaya is heard and determined.

At the same time, Justice John Mativo has issued orders blocking the arrest of Magaya over the demos.

Last week, the Acting Interior CS said Magaya would be arrested since he is the one who wrote to Nairobi Police Commander alerting him about planned NASA protest which turned chaotic on Wednesday.
